수영만의 조류, 염분 및 부유물질의 분포
Distributions of Tidal Current, Salinity and Suspended Sediment in Suyoung Bay
- KIM Cha-Kyum (Department of Ocean Engineering, National Fisheries University of Pusan) ;
- LEE Jong-Sup (Department of Ocean Engineering, National Fisheries University of Pusan)
- 발행 : 1992.09.01
초록
To investigate the flow pattern and mixing process in Suyoung Bay, field observations and data analyses of tidal current, salinity and suspended sediment (SS) were carried out. Ebb flow is stronger than flood flow, and duration of ebb tide is longer than that of flood tide. Semi-diurnal component of tidal current is predominant, and current rotating clockwise occurs in the central part of the bay. The direction of the residual currents in the central part of the bay and offshore is almost N to WNW, and the speed is 4-14cm/s.
